Powered Air-Purifying Respirator (PAPR) and High-Efficiency Particulate Air (HEPA) Buggies to Improve COVID-19 Safety for the Youngest Children: Evaluation of Prototypes

Introduction: Young children are susceptible to COVID-19 infection in high-risk settings because they cannot begin vaccination until at least 6 months old and cannot mask safely until at least 2 years old. During essential activities, parents have attempted to protect children in stro...

Seconded. You can also make them from pretty much any fan and in different configurations:

For example, it is far cheaper for me to acquire MERV-13 furnace filters in the size most commonly used here instead of the square filters.

I also make life easier for myself by constructing a frame from coroplast and tape (or hot glue -- either works) which makes swapping out filters a cinch.

Thousands of patients caught COVID in NSW hospitals last year and hundreds died, new data shows

Thousands of patients caught COVID in NSW public hospitals last year and hundreds died, fuelling concerns among infection control experts that hospitals are not taking strong enough precautions against airborne viruses.

Science in Action: How to Build a Corsi-Rosenthal Box

Learn how to build a Corsi-Rosenthal box. The device was created to provide significant reduction in the amount of virus-laden, aerosol particles that are in the air. Follow along as Dean Richard L. Corsi, co-inventor, shows you the major components of this device, and how to build one.
